On Tue, Jan 4, 2011 at 12:43 PM, Joel Reymont wrote: > > Is there a large number of people here wanting to use SWIG bindings for OCaml? > > Do you all wrap large-surface APIs manually and are happy doing so? > I would like to use SWIG. That said, for the range of functions it works for, camlidl seems to provide much cleaner bindings to C libraries than SWIG. If SWIG could be used to create similarly clean bindings without requiring a syntax extension or very verbose OCaml code then it would be much more attractive. Hez
